What Is Cross Platform App Development?


Cross platform app development refers to building a single application that runs on multiple operating systems  typically Android and iOS  using one shared codebase, rather than writing separate native apps for each platform. This approach dramatically reduces development effort while still delivering a high-quality user experience.

Why Flutter Leads the Cross-Platform Race


1. Native-Like Performance


Unlike older hybrid frameworks that rely on WebViews, Flutter compiles directly to native ARM code, resulting in smooth animations and fast load times.

2. Full UI Control


Flutter's widget-based rendering engine means developers aren't limited by platform-specific UI components  they can design pixel-perfect, brand-consistent interfaces across every device.

3. Hot Reload for Faster Iteration


Flutter's hot reload feature lets developers see code changes instantly, speeding up the development and debugging process significantly.

4. One Codebase, Multiple Outputs


A single Flutter codebase can be compiled for Android, iOS, web, Windows, macOS, and Linux  a major advantage for businesses wanting maximum reach with minimal duplicated effort.

5. Strong Backing and Ecosystem


Backed by Google and supported by a large open-source community, Flutter continues to receive regular updates, new packages, and long-term stability.

When Cross-Platform Development Makes the Most Sense



  • Launching an MVP quickly to validate a business idea

  • Building apps with standard UI patterns (e-commerce, booking, social, productivity)

  • Startups with limited budgets needing to maximize platform reach

  • Enterprises wanting to modernize legacy apps across multiple platforms simultaneously

  • Agencies offering white label Flutter app development services to multiple clients


When Native Development Might Still Be Preferred



  • Apps requiring deep integration with platform-specific hardware (advanced AR/VR, specialized sensors)

  • Extremely performance-sensitive applications like high-end gaming

  • Projects where the team already has deep native expertise and no cross-platform experience

FAQs


1. Is Flutter better than React Native for cross-platform development? 


Both are strong frameworks, but Flutter often has an edge in UI consistency and performance since it doesn't rely on a JavaScript bridge like React Native does.

2. Does cross-platform development mean lower app quality? 


Not with modern frameworks like Flutter. Apps built this way can match native performance and design quality for the vast majority of use cases.

3. How much cost can cross-platform development actually save? 


Businesses often report 30-50% savings in development cost and time compared to building separate native apps for Android and iOS.

4. Can a cross-platform app later be optimized for platform-specific features? 


Yes. Flutter supports platform channels that allow developers to write native code for specific features when needed, without abandoning the cross-platform codebase.

5. Is cross-platform development suitable for enterprise-grade apps? 


Yes. Many large enterprises use Flutter for production-grade apps, proving it scales well beyond simple MVPs.
